[QUOTE="BrokenBackJack, post: 133997, member: 642"] Had a buddy that had the King Kat 760. Out riding one weekend and we were really hauling ass across a field and he hit a big rock dead center and caved the front end in and the front tip of the skis were bent around hugging the rock. He flew like a bird. Can still see that in my mind. We really laughed about it later. He got to laugh at me later as we were riding again and came flying up to a slough that had the grass cut and snow was about 3'' deep. Anyway it was swathed and not baled and my skis went into the swath and the sled stopped cold and i kept going busting off the windshield and thought i left my nuts on the handle bars. Couldn't move for quite awhile after that. Hurt so bad i was puking and he was standing there laughing his ass off. Use to race Arctic Cats and Rupp sleds. Had lots of fun and met some great people. Those old sleds road like a stone boat and we thought they were fast. They were heavy as can be. Would like to ride a new one (not very far) just to see how it rides and how it handles compared to our old dinosaurs. Sure beat walking and made the winters go faster too. We used to get snow back then too. [/QUOTE]
